Question for Vietnam vets
 
My BFF and I are planning on a trip this winter. She has mentioned going to Vietnam. It seems everyday I see vets proudly displaying their service on hats, t-shirts and license plates. So I want to ask a question

Is it insensitive to think about tourist travel to Vietnam? How do you feel about it. I don't ever want to offend anyone.

Go, enjoy the country and the people. As a Vietnam vet, I would never go back despite the wonderful peasants outside of the cities that I worked with. I provided medical assistance to villages that had few men and boys, but lots of women and their children who experienced hardships that are incomprehensible to most Americans. They always had a smile for me and occasionally gave me gifts of their last possessions. I don't know a Vietnam vet who would think you as insensitive because of your travel dreams.

I have a friend who is married to a lovely Vietnamese and are actually in Vietnam as I write this. His wife is from a small village ( Cu Chi ) outside of Saigon ( Ho Chi Minh ). My friend normally stays in Nha Trang..N East of Saigon and is it is beautiful with white sandy beaches.

I happened to be stationed there, Can Tho, 68/69 Binh Thuy AFB, located in the Mekong Delta, and would really love to go back. It is a beautiful country and well worth visiting, also very inexpensive.
